About Us

We are the largest GP super-partnerships in the UK, with a list size of 450,000 patients and with a multi-disciplinary workforce of 1500 staff. We are unique, always looking at ways to improve our delivery of services through the implementation of new and innovative solutions that we can scale across the organisation. Recent innovations have included the use of robots to facilitate the remote filing of blood results and the development of document management team. These new initiatives are underpinned by our governance team to ensure patient safety.
